- The distance between Dillon, Mt, Usa and Fernando De Noronha, Brazil is approximately 9,574 km or 5,950 mi.
- To reach Dillon, Mt in this distance one would set out from Fernando De Noronha bearing 315.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Dillon, Mt bearing 279.4° or W .
- Dillon, Mt has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Fernando De Noronha has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As).
- The average annual temperature is 19.9 °C (35.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.8 °C (39.2°F) more in Dillon, Mt.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1123.7 mm (44.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1123.7 l/m² (27.58 US gal/ft²) or 11,237,000 l/ha (1,201,310 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.3° lower in Dillon, Mt than in Fernando De Noronha.
